Water Softener Installation in Columbus, OH
Water softener installation services involve adding a specialized system to a property’s plumbing to reduce hard water issues. These systems work by removing minerals like calcium and magnesium that can cause scale buildup, improve the efficiency of appliances, and extend the lifespan of plumbing fixtures. Projects typically include installing new units in homes experiencing mineral deposits, soap scum, or dry skin, as well as replacing outdated or malfunctioning softeners. Property owners usually want to understand the different types of softeners available, the installation process, and any maintenance requirements to ensure the system functions effectively over time.
Before requesting water softener installation, homeowners should consider the size of their household, water hardness levels, and existing plumbing configurations. It’s also helpful to know whether the property has specific plumbing restrictions or space limitations that could influence the type of system chosen. Understanding these factors can help ensure the selected water softening solution meets the household’s needs for cleaner dishes, softer laundry, and improved water quality throughout the home.

Common Water Softener Installation Jobs
Water Softener Installation - professional setup to reduce mineral buildup in plumbing and appliances.
Whole-House Water Softening - installation of systems that treat all water entering a home for improved quality.
Point-of-Use Water Softeners - targeted softening solutions for specific faucets or appliances.
Salt-Based Water Softener Systems - installation of systems that use salt to remove hardness minerals.
Salt-Free Water Conditioners - alternative softening options that prevent scale without salt use.
Water Softener Upgrades - replacing or enhancing existing systems for better performance and efficiency.
Water Softener Installation Questions
What is a water softener? A device that removes minerals like calcium and magnesium from water to prevent hard water issues in the home.
Why install a water softener? It helps reduce scale buildup, extends appliance life, and improves soap and detergent effectiveness.
Where can a water softener be installed? Typically, it is installed at the main water entry point to treat all household water supply.
What type of water softener is suitable? There are different systems, including salt-based and salt-free options, suitable for various needs and preferences.
